Ralph McLean Is Running for The Green Party in Our Federal Riding.

The Pas native Ralph McLean will be running in the upcoming federal election for the Green Party in our riding of Churchill Keewatinook  Aski.  McLean originally got involved with the Green Party about 12 years ago and decided move back to Northern Manitoba to run for MP for our riding after living in Alberta for a few years.

He states being Indigenous he wants to make sure that Indigenous issues are coming forward especially for our riding like we need affordable housing, we need clean drinking water, infrastructure, we obviously need more work on the rail line, there’s a lot of environmental clean ups, we need a sewage lagoon for The Pas and there’s a lot of lithium in the north and we’re going to need to get at that. McLean added that there is a lot of growth and opportunity for our region and the people here have a lot to offer.
